tag Docker

標籤
貢獻331
319
06:37 AM · Oct 27 ,2025

@Docker / 博客 RSS 訂閱

savokiss - [譯] 寫給前端工程師的 Docker 入門

為什麼我們要用 docker ? 過去的我們,當業務發展需要部署新的應用時,DevOps 小夥伴通常會去買一台服務器,但是卻不知道這個新應用具體需要多高的配置,往往都會造成資源浪費。 當虛擬機出現後,它可以讓我們在一台服務器上運行多個應用,但是卻有一個缺陷。每個 VM 需要運行一整個的操作系統。每個 OS 又需要 CPU、RAM 等等,需要打補丁、安裝證書,這些反過來又增加了成本和彈性。 Goog

node.js , frontend , Docker

收藏 評論

shanyue - 使用 docker 高效部署前端應用

docker 變得越來越流行,它可以輕便靈活地隔離環境,進行擴容,方便運維管理。對開發者也更方便開發,測試與部署。 最重要的是,當你面對一個陌生的項目,你可以照着 Dockerfile,甚至不看文檔(文檔也不一定全,全也不一定對)就可以很快讓它在本地跑起來。 現在很強調 devops 的理念,我把 devops 五個大字放在電腦桌面上,格物致知了一天。豁然開朗,devops 的意思就是寫一個 Do

node.js , frontend , Docker

收藏 評論

胡斐 - Docker 第一次上手

Docker第一次上手 引言 DevOps/開發運維/不懂運維和部署的前端開發 項目實際需要,平穩升級構建工具 安裝Docker 去看官網就好了 涉及的幾個命令 dockerimages ![dockerimages](./assets/docker-images.jpg) dockerbuild -t指定image的repository和tag,這兩項的含義可

node.js , frontend , Docker , 前端 , Javascript

收藏 評論

阿里云云原生 - 基於 Wasm 和 ORAS 簡化擴展服務網格功能

作者 | 王夕寧 阿里雲高級技術專家 來源 | 阿里巴巴雲原生公眾號 本文將介紹如何使用 ORAS 客户端將具有允許的媒體類型的 Wasm 模塊推送到 ACR 註冊庫(一個 OCI 兼容的註冊庫)中,然後通過 ASM 控制器將 Wasm Filter 部署到指定工作負載對應的 Pod 中。Wasm Filter 部署中的所有步驟都使用聲明方式,也就是説可以創建一個自定義資源 CRD 來描述

容器 , kubernetes , 微服務 , yii2 , Docker

收藏 評論

Yujiaao - 設置PHP,PHP-FPM和NGINX以在Docker上進行本地開發

pascallandau.com 設置PHP,PHP-FPM和NGINX以在Docker上進行本地開發 Windows 10下Docker上PHP入門。 帕斯卡·蘭道(Pascal Landau)發表於2018-07-08 22:00:00 您可能從新來的孩子那裏聽到了一個叫做“Docker”的消息?您是一名PHP開發人員,並且願意參與其中,但是您沒有時間研究它嗎?然後,本教程適合您!到最後,您應

php , php-fpm , windows10 , Docker

收藏 評論

對你無可奈何 - Kuberntes中Sysctl中的配置(php-fpm併發只能300)

背景: kubernetes集羣中部署應用,對應用進行壓力測試。jmeter進行壓力測試大概是每秒300個左右的請求(每分鐘elasticsearch中採集的請求有18000個)。查看日誌有nginx的erro log: ​ 但是我的cpu 內存資源也都沒有打滿。通過搜索引擎搜索發現與下面博客的環境基本相似,php-fpm也是走的socket: ​ 參見:http://

kubernetes , php-fpm , 運維 , Nginx , Docker

收藏 評論

劉悦的技術博客 - 四位一體水溶交融,Docker一拖三Tornado6.2 + Nginx + Supervisord非阻塞負載均衡容器式部署實踐

原文轉載自「劉悦的技術博客」https://v3u.cn/a_id_203 容器,又見容器。Docker容器的最主要優點就在於它們是可移植的。一套服務,其所有的依賴關係可以捆綁到一個獨立於Linux內核、平台分佈或部署模型的主機版本的單個容器中。此容器可以傳輸到另一台運行Docker的主機上,並且在沒有兼容性問題的情況下執行。而傳統的微服務架構會將各個服務單獨封裝為容器,雖然微服務容器化環境能夠在

python3.x , tornado , dockerfile , Nginx , Docker

收藏 評論

逆熵流 - Docker 入門私人筆記(八)使用 Supervisor 管理容器多進程

Supervisor 是一個 C/S 模式的進程管理工具。它使用 Python 開發。支持 Linux/Unix 系統,不支持 Windows 系統。它的功能包含監聽、啓動、停止、重啓一個或多個進程。用 Supervisor 管理進程,當一個進程掛掉並且被 supervisort 監聽到之後,可以自動將它重新拉起,即做到進程自動恢復的功能,不再需要寫 shell 腳本來控制。 實戰:製作 supe

容器 , supervisor , 進程 , Docker , 多進程

收藏 評論

從君華 - react使用BrowserRouter部署到docker的httpd刷新頁面報錯Not Found(404)解決方案

找到httpd.conf配置文件(/usr/local/apache2/conf) 進入編輯 找到#LoadModule rewrite_module modules/mod_rewrite.so這一行並取消註釋 找到所有的AllowOverride,將默認值none修改為All(大約有三處,不要漏) 在項目根目錄(/usr/local/apache2/htdocs)新建.htacce

httpd , 部署 , react-router , 路由 , Docker

收藏 評論

鳩摩智首席音效師 - 解決 docker 掛載 php-fpm 配置文件無效問題

本來是想把 php-fpm 的配置文件獨立出來,這樣修改起來就方便,想當然的認為把 www.conf 配置文件掛載出來就好了,docker-compose.yml 中 PHP 容器部分內容如下: volumes: - ./html:/var/www/html - ./php/log:/var/log/php-fpm - ./php/conf.d/php.ini:/usr/local/e

php-fpm , Docker

收藏 評論

ViggoZ - 獨立產品靈感週刊 DecoHack #045 - 新春程序員尋找“副業”靈感指南

本週刊記錄有趣好玩的獨立產品設計開發相關內容,每週發佈,往期內容同樣精彩,感興趣的夥伴可以點擊訂閲我的週刊。為保證每期都能收到,建議郵件訂閲。歡迎通過 Twitter 私信推薦或投稿。 春節後的第一期來了,過年出去玩了,鴿了一期週刊,這周也算是新的一年開始了,今年會繼續給大家分享一些我每週看到的好玩有趣賺錢不賺錢的產品。 💻 產品推薦 1. LEMO FM-白噪音、放鬆、專注、深度睡眠 是一款比

graphql , Docker , xss , Ubuntu

收藏 評論

南玖 - Docker從入門到部署項目

Docker概念 Docker是一個開源的應用容器引擎,它是基於Go語言並遵從Apache2.0協議開源。Docker可以讓開發者打包他們的應用以及依賴包到一個輕量級、可移植的容器中,然後發佈到任何流行的linux機器上,也可以實現虛擬化。通過容器可以實現方便快速並且與平台解耦的自動化部署方式,無論你部署時的環境如何,容器中的應用程序都會運行在同一種環境下。並且它是完全使用沙箱機制,相互之間是隔離

容器 , 工程化 , Docker

收藏 評論

潤雨冰雪 - 一次容器裏的殭屍進程排查

背景 “大棟老師”的一個應用,經常會有殭屍進程產生。程序的調用邏輯大概如下: 主進程A產生多個B類進程B1,B2,B3等,每一個B類進程又產生了若干個C類進程,C1,C2,C3,現象就是容器中會出現部分C進程的殭屍進程。 經過簡單的分析發現是一些B類進程先結束,導致一些C類進程成為殭屍進程。但是這個不符合常規的邏輯,因為正常情況下父進程如果結束,子進程會成為孤兒進程,從而被內核的1號進

bash , Docker , go

收藏 評論

潤雨冰雪 - 一次容器裏的殭屍進程排查2

前序 上次的排查,我們發現在容器裏golang進程作為1號進程的時候不具備等待孤兒進程退出狀態的能力,但是bash就可以,帶着這個問題,我們進一步研究。 尋找思路 我們再次看下維基百科對於殭屍進程的定義。 殭屍進程定義 對於裏面的內容,我們不逐字逐句分析,其中有一句話 子進程死後,系統會發送SIGCHLD信號給父進程,父進程對其默認處理是忽略。如果想響應這個消息,父進程通常在信號事件處理程序中,使

bash , Docker , go

收藏 評論

GousterCloud - 通過 IntelliJ IDEA 對 containerd 進行源碼級調試

[TOC] 本文介紹如何在 Ubuntu 22.04 系統上,通過 IntelliJ IDEA 對 containerd 進行源碼級調試。我們將從 containerd 的安裝、源碼編譯、驗證調試信息的存在,到最終的調試過程中,每一步驟都進行詳細講解。 1 安裝 containerd 📦 首先,按照以下鏈接中的指引完成 containerd 的安裝過程:Ubuntu 22.04 安裝 conta

容器 , intellij-idea , debugging , containerd , Docker

收藏 評論

潘傑 - 如何在docker被屏蔽的情況下,在debian上安裝docker engine

最後docker因於不知道的某些原因被屏蔽了,這使得我們無論在拉取官方鏡像方面還是在進行安裝方面都需要一點點技巧。 既然docker不能夠直接訪問,所以如果想安裝docker engine成功的前提是:有個可以連通外網的代理。在本文中,假設代理的地址為:http://192.168.20.3:7890。同時,由於我們參考官方的文檔來進行安裝,所以我們還需要一台可以在瀏覽器中打開docker官方的計

install , Debian , 代理 , Docker

收藏 評論

張飛的豬 - 如何在Linux雲服務器上通過Docker Compose部署安裝Halo,搭建個人博客網站?

前置步驟 首先你需要一套linux服務器,這裏默認你已經有了。如果沒有可以在雲服務器優惠合集選擇,如果你是個人博客選擇性價比最高,最低配置就夠用了。 環境搭建 按照Docker官方文檔安裝Docker和Docker Compose,部分Linux發行版軟件倉庫中的 Docker版本可能過舊。 Docker 安裝文檔:https://docs.docker.com/engine/install/

網站部署 , Linux , 網站 , 網站建設 , Docker

收藏 評論

Chuck1sn - 一套全新的 Java 技術棧,一種現代化的 Java 編程方式。

Mjga 是一款全新設計並打造的 Java Web 腳手架,帶給你一種現代化的 Java 編程體驗。 訪問地址: https://www.mjga.cc 視頻教程(持續更新中) 1. 快速啓動腳手架與常用命令簡介 2. 文件結構詳解和 Docker 集成思路 技術選型 DataBase First - 視數據庫為一等公民 設計理念 容器化與雲原生 🍋 通過 doc

postgresql , springboot , JAVA , gradle , Docker

收藏 評論

藍易雲 - python模塊之sys

Python的 sys模塊是用於訪問和操作與Python解釋器相關的變量和功能的標準庫模塊。以下是關於 sys模塊的一些重要功能: 命令行參數: 通過 sys.argv可以訪問命令行參數列表。 標準輸入輸出: sys.stdin、sys.stdout和 sys.stderr分別表示標準輸入、標準輸出和標準錯誤輸出。 退出程序: 使用 sys.exit()可以退出Python程序。

vagrant , 運維 , Docker , jenkins , apache

收藏 評論

Java陳序員 - 微軟開源!Office 文檔輕鬆轉 Markdown!

大家好,我是 Java陳序員。 今天,給大家介紹一款微軟開源的文檔轉 Markdown 工具。 關注微信公眾號:【Java陳序員】,獲取開源項目分享、AI副業分享、超200本經典計算機電子書籍等。 項目介紹 MarkItDown —— 微軟開源的 Python 工具,能夠將多種常見的文件格式(如 PDF、PowerPoint、Word、Excel、圖像、音頻和 HTML 等)轉換為 Mark

github , Docker , Markdown , Python

收藏 評論

Damon小智 - 微信小程序-Docker+Nginx環境配置業務域名驗證文件

在實際開發或運維工作中,我們時常需要在 Nginx 部署的服務器上提供一個特定的靜態文件,用於域名驗證或第三方平台驗證。若此時使用 Docker 容器部署了 Nginx,就需要將該驗證文件正確地映射(掛載)到容器中,並通過 Nginx 配置讓外部訪問到它。本篇文章將介紹如何在已有的 Docker Compose + Nginx 環境裏,順利配置並訪問靜態驗證文件。 一、下載驗證文件 訪問小程序管

微信 , 小程序 , 運維 , Nginx , Docker

收藏 評論

Chuck1sn - 🔥 一個全新設計的 Java 腳手架;一副嶄新的 Java 生態藍圖;一門現代化的 Java 編程哲學。

為何 Mjga 與眾不同? Mjga 是一款全新設計的,基於雲原生理念的打造的現代 Java Web 腳手架,它具備以下特點: 容器化的應用 可裝卸的組件 有口皆碑的單元測試 自定義元信息 全新的生產力工具 🥝 選擇模板 🍅 組件選配 🍹 自定義元信息 產品特性 容器化與雲原生 通過 docker-compose.yml 管理應用程序的整個生命週期與配置。 通過

單元測試 , springboot , JAVA , gradle , Docker

收藏 評論

Chuck1sn - 《你不知道的 JAVA 系列博客》🔥 分頁查詢的達芬奇密碼。

工程思維落地 《你不知道的 Java 系列》已將工程思維與設計理念落地,形成了一款全新設計的 Java 腳手架 ,可與博客配套使用。 前言 你可能很熟悉 Mybatis,但是今天我們不講這個基於字符串拼接的上古時代的庫。今天我們談一個基於 QueryDSL 實現的庫。(這個庫第一個版本誕生自 2009年),他叫做 JOOQ。 JOOQ 可以用一句話總結:當你在使用 JOOQ 的時候,你就是在使用

springsecurity , springboot , JAVA , gradle , Docker

收藏 評論

qbit - docker 命令備忘(qbit)

前言 軟件版本 docker: 20.10.8 docker-compose: 1.29.2 Docker Github 倉庫: https://github.com/docker 容器內 SHELL 進入容器內 shell docker exec -it nextcloud bash 容器的拉取、查看、運行、重啓 搜索容器(nginx) $

卷管理器 , 掛載硬盤 , Docker , shell

收藏 評論